Step 1: Sizzle the Sausage

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add Italian sausage and break it into crumbles while cooking. Cook until golden brown and completely done, around 7-10 minutes. Drain excess fat, keeping about in the pot.

Step 2: Awaken Aromatics

Toss in minced garlic and chopped onion. Sauté until they become soft and release their fragrant essence, about 3-4 minutes.

Step 3: Build the Flavor Foundation

Mix in diced tomatoes with their juices and chicken broth. Bring the mixture to a gentle bubble.

Step 4: Pasta Perfection

Drop rigatoni directly into the pot. Stir to combine ingredients. Cover and cook for 10-12 minutes, stirring occasionally, until pasta reaches tender al dente texture and absorbs most liquid.

Step 5: Luxurious Cream Transformation

Lower heat and slowly blend in heavy cream. Continue cooking, stirring frequently, until sauce thickens slightly, around 3-5 minutes.

Step 6: Final Flourish

Fold in fresh spinach and cook until wilted, about 2 minutes. Sprinkle in Parmesan cheese. Season with:
  • Salt
  • Black pepper
  • Red pepper flakes (optional)

Stir until cheese melts and pasta becomes completely coated with creamy goodness.

  • Refrigerate Leftovers: Transfer the remaining pasta to an airtight container and store in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. Let the dish cool completely before sealing to prevent moisture buildup and maintain optimal flavor.
  • Microwave Reheating: Warm individual portions in the microwave, adding a splash of chicken broth or water to prevent drying. Heat in 30-second intervals, stirring between each interval, until the pasta reaches a steaming hot temperature throughout.
  • Stovetop Refresh: Revive the pasta's creamy texture by reheating in a skillet over medium-low heat. Add a small amount of broth or cream, stirring gently to restore moisture and prevent sticking. Continue heating until warmed through, typically 4-5 minutes.

New Twists for Your Italian Sausage Rigatoni

  • Spicy Chorizo Kick: Replace Italian sausage with spicy chorizo for a bold, smoky flavor profile. Add roasted red peppers and swap Parmesan for pepper jack cheese to enhance the heat.
  • Mediterranean Lamb Fusion: Substitute sausage with ground lamb and incorporate crumbled feta cheese. Introduce oregano and mint for an authentic Greek-inspired taste. Use sun-dried tomatoes instead of regular diced tomatoes.
  • Vegetarian Mushroom Blend: Swap sausage with a mix of wild mushrooms like shiitake, cremini, and oyster. Add extra garlic and include nutritional yeast for a rich, umami flavor. Include roasted zucchini and bell peppers for additional depth.
  • Seafood Coastal Edition: Replace sausage with fresh shrimp or crab meat. Incorporate white wine instead of chicken broth. Add lemon zest and fresh herbs like parsley and basil. Use lighter cream or half-and-half for a more delicate sauce.

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ients:

  • 1 lb Italian sausage (casings removed)
  • 12 oz (340 grams) rigatoni pasta
  • 2 cups fresh spinach
  • 1 can (14.5 oz or 411 grams) diced tomatoes, undrained

Flavor Enhancers:

  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• ½ cup onion, finely chopped
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il (if needed)

Liquid and Seasoning Ingredients:

  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Red pepper flakes (optional, for heat)

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ium temperature, carefully place Italian sausage into the pan, and methodically crumble the meat while cooking until rich golden brown and completely done, approximately 7-10 minutes.
  2. Carefully drain excess fat, leaving roughly in the cooking vessel, then introduce finely chopped onions and minced garlic, sautéing until aromatic and transl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
  3. Pour diced tomatoes with their natural juices and chicken broth into the mixture, gently stirring to combine and creating a harmonious liquid base.
  4. Directly add rigatoni pasta into the simmering liquid, thoroughly mixing to ensure even distribution, then cover and allow to cook for 10-12 minutes, periodically stirring to prevent sticking and achieve perfect al dente texture.
  5. Reduce cooking temperature to low, gradually incorporate heavy cream, stirring consistently to create a smooth, velvety sauce that gently thickens over 3-5 minutes.
  6. Introduce fresh spinach leaves, folding them into the creamy mixture until they delicately wilt and integrate, approximately 2 minutes.
  7. Finish by sprinkling grated Parmesan cheese, seasoning with salt, black pepper, and optional red pepper flakes, stirring until cheese melts completely and coats the pasta uniformly.

Notes

  • Meal Prep Magic: Chop garlic, onions, and measure ingredients beforehand to streamline the cooking process and reduce kitchen stress.
  • Sausage Selection: Choose high-quality Italian sausage for richer flavor, preferably with a mix of mild and spicy varieties to add depth to the dish.
  • Liquid Absorption Trick: Adding pasta directly to the sauce allows it to soak up more flavor and creates a creamy, cohesive texture without extra dishes.
  • Cheese Melting Technique: Add Parmesan gradually and off direct heat to prevent separation and ensure smooth, silky sauce consistency.
  • Spinach Fresh Factor: Add spinach at the last moment to maintain its bright green color and prevent overcooking, preserving nutrients and texture.
  • Spice Customization: Adjust red pepper flakes to personal heat preference, allowing each person to control the dish’s spiciness.
